Coinbase launched Coinbase for Agents, a new product that lets users connect AI agents directly to their Coinbase accounts so the agents can trade, make payments, and execute financial workflows within user defined limits.

The product is available starting today as an MCP and command line interface, according to Coinbase. The company said the tool is designed to let AI agents move beyond financial research and into execution, giving them access to trading and spending functions once a user grants permission.

Coinbase said users can ask an agent to rebalance a portfolio, set limit orders, monitor idle cash, pay for data services, or run recurring crypto purchases based on preset instructions.

Spot and derivatives crypto trading are available today, while Coinbase said it plans to expand capabilities to stocks, index funds, prediction markets, and commodities.

The launch marks Coinbase’s latest push into agentic finance, where AI systems operate across apps and financial services on behalf of users. The company said Coinbase for Agents can operate inside an isolated portfolio or through a user’s main Coinbase account, with access restricted to what the user allows.
